Applications of Fluke Moisture Meters

  • Building Inspections: Detect moisture damage in walls, floors, ceilings, and other building components.
  • Woodworking: Ensure proper moisture levels in lumber for optimal quality and durability.
  • Concrete Testing: Monitor moisture content in concrete slabs and structures to prevent cracking and other issues.
  • HVAC Maintenance: Diagnose moisture-related problems in air conditioning systems.

Types of Fluke Moisture Meters

  • Probe-Type: Inserted into the material to measure moisture content directly.
  • Pin-Type: Pierces the material’s surface to assess moisture levels.
  • Non-Contact (Capacitive): Detects moisture near the surface without puncturing the material.
